In the Supreme Court of New Zealand
Auckland Registry

IN THE MATTER of the Companies Act 1955, and IN THE MATTER
of HOCHS YOGHURT LIMITED, a duly incorporated company
having its registered office C/- Messrs. R. W. Smith &
Chilcott, Chartered Accountants, 129 Albert Street, Auckland, l and carrying on business as a dairy products manufacturer:

NOTICE is hereby given that a petition for the winding up of
the abovenamed company by the Supreme Court was on the
19th day of March 1975 presented to the said Court by FLO
LINE PLASTICS LIMITED, a duly incorporated company having
its registered office at 61-69 Patiki Road, Avondale, Auckland,
and carrying on business as a manufacturer of plastic products, and that the said petition is directed to be heard before
the Court sitting at Auckland on the 14th day of May 1975
at 10 o'clock in the forenoon and any creditor or contributory
of the said company desirous to support or oppose the making
of an order on the said petition may appear at the time
of hearing in person or by his counsel for that purpose and a
copy of the petition will be furnished by the undersigned to
any creditor or contributory of the said company requiring a
copy on payment of the regulated charge for the same.

B. N. DAVIDSON, Solicitor for the Petitioner.

Address for service: The offices of Messieurs Rudd, Garland & Horrocks, Solicitors, A.M.P. Building, Queen Street, Auckland.

NOTE—Any person who intends to appear on the hearing
of the said petition must serve on or send by post, to the
above-named, notice in writing of his intention so to do. The
notice must state the name, address, and description of the
person or, if a firm the name, address and description of the
firm, and an address for service within 3 miles of the office
of the Supreme Court at Auckland, and must be signed by
the person or firm, or his or their solicitor (if any), and must
be served, or, if posted, must be sent by post in sufficient time
to reach the above-named petitioner’s address for service not
later than 4 o'clock in the afternoon of the 13th day of May
1975.

WELLINGTON CITY COUNCIL

NOTICE OF INTENTION TO TAKE LAND

IN the matter of the Public Works Act 1928, the Municipal
Corporations Act 1954, the Urban Renewal and Housing
Improvement Act 1945, and their respective amendments:

NOTICE is hereby given that the Wellington City Council
proposes under the provisions of the above-named Acts and
all other Acts, powers, and authorities enabling it in that
behalf to execute a certain public work, namely, for the
purposes of Part II of the Urban Renewal and Housing
Improvement Act 1945 in the City of Wellington and for
the purpose of that public work the lands described in the
Schedules hereto are required to be taken. And notice is
hereby further given that plans of the lands which are required
to be taken are deposited in the public office of the Town
Clerk to the said Council in the Municipal Office Building,
5 Mercer Street, Wellington, and are there open for inspection, without fee, by all persons during ordinary office hours
and that any person affected by the execution of the said
public work or the taking of the said lands should if he has
any objection to the execution of the said public work or to
the taking of the said lands, not being an objection to amount
or payment of compensation, send his written objection within
40 days from the first publication of this notice to the Town
and Country Planning Appeal Board, 32 Mulgrave Street,
Wellington, at his said office. And notice is hereby further
given that if any objection is made as aforesaid a public
hearing of that objection will be held unless the objector
otherwise requires and each objector will be advised of the
time and place of that hearing and at that hearing each
objector will be advised of the reasons for the proposed taking.
